    Position Overview:

    The primary responsibility of this role is to lead projects in the plan, design development, and implementation of automation solutions for manufacturing processes, integrate and program electrical components and robots and lead, execute improvement initiatives, and ensure that systems and processes are in place to meet and exceed company's quality and production objectives safely and efficiently.

    This position will report to the Manufacturing Engineering Manager.

    What you will be doing:

    • Create detailed automation design proposal including controls design, electrical and pneumatic, specifying hardware and components, testing, commissioning, and validation. Develop and verify safety systems, understand safety risk assessments
    • Interpret/read/write electrical and electronic schematics/diagrams, basic hydraulic and pneumatic diagrams
    • Prepare and release drawings for new projects, record changes diligently, and release updated drawings
    • Install, program, and integrate PLC, HMI, robots, tooling, drives, actuators, sensors, vision systems, start-up, debugging and compliance with internal and customer standards
    • Program and maintain robots online/offline using (CIM Station, Fanuc Weld Pro, MotoSim, and Robot Studio)
    • Provide ideas to automate manual operations, assist and present ROI (return on investment) studies for justification and approval
    • Integrate specialized hardware and software into manufacturing systems to enhance automation and control with an emphasis on efficiency and throughput improvements and cycle time reductions
    • Responsible for preparing training documentation, work instructions, and procedures for effective handover to production and maintenance
    • Manage and/or assist assigned manufacturing engineer to monitor equipment and tooling suppliers' progress through quotation, design, build, and installation stages of all new equipment necessary for new programs and improvements or retrofits on current processes and equipment
    • Participate and contribute in cross-functional APQP meetings to provide input in DFM and GDT analysis, PFMEA, control plans, process capability studies, DOE's, poka-yoke, error-proof plans, root cause analysis, lessons learned
    • Assist in running lab tests, and compiling and analyzing test data
    • Assist and coordinate equipment design reviews with assigned manufacturing engineer and supplier(s) using Active's standard Design Review and Sign-Off Checklist to record open issues and follow up for successful closure
    • Assist assigned manufacturing engineer with all equipment sample runs at the supplier(s) and Active to ensure a successful run at rate milestone completion based on TAKT time, internal AQPQ, and customer PPAP requirements and standards
    • Evaluate equipment trial runs and buy-offs with assigned manufacturing engineers for new equipment and retrofits and ensure run and rate, PPH, and essential safety regulations are met per Active, OHSA, ESA, and CSA standards.
    • Conduct training for associates on new equipment and processes, monitor progress and ensure timely and effective handover to production and maintenance using Active's standard Machine Handover Checklist
    • Record and compile lessons learned and ensure carry-over on future programs/processes/equipment
    • Establish Active New Machine Equipment Specifications
    • Work closely with plant maintenance staff in troubleshooting equipment issues involving electrical, electromechanical, pneumatic, electronics, and PLC programming
    • Aid with specifications for the purchase of electrical components
    • Provide expert opinion and guidance on machine and equipment purchase
    • Participate in process and equipment root cause analysis initiatives and implement solutions to improve and sustain OEE to Active's standards
    • Maintain an open issues matrix for assigned projects and tasks and ensure timely completion as agreed with the direct manager
    • Lead and participate in 8D, 5 Why's, RCA, and CI meetings for customer complaints, and failures and provide appropriate input to resolve issues
    • Work closely with the maintenance/tooling manager and skill trades team to increase machine uptime, conduct RCA on equipment issues and follow up on closure
    • Support the implementation of best practices for the department and the development, monitoring, and application of KPIs (productivity, cost, quality, safety)
    • Other duties as required

    What you bring along:

    • Bachelor of Electrical Engineering, Control Systems, Robotics, Automation or Mechatronics, Systems Engineering
    • P. Eng. designation from PEO desirable
    • Lean Six Sigma Black Belt or Green Belt desirable
    • Project management experience; PMP designation desirable
    • Must have 5-10 years of verifiable experience in controls and automation in the automation industry or manufacturing environment
    • Proficient in AutoCAD Electrical or similar package(s)
    • Able to read wiring diagrams, electrical/mechanical/pneumatic/hydraulic schematics, and ladder/function block/ST logic, you have working knowledge of industrial PCs and PLCs (Beckhoff, Siemens, AB, etc.) and electric circuits consisting of contractors, relays, main voltage/control voltage, limit switches, and proximity sensors, etc.
    • Hands-on experience applying electronics, pneumatics, and electromechanical devices is a must
    • Perform basic wiring work and general installations, identify causes of problems while developing methods of correction
    • Knowledge of and ability to troubleshoot industrial networks, machine safety circuits, and applications
    • Understanding of VFD, DC, and Servo Drive systems
    • Proficient in industrial machine controls, electrical systems, PLC, and HMI programming
    • Able to create AutoCAD Electrical drawings for assembly and wiring control panels and instrumentation
    • Program Beckhoff/Allen-Bradley/Omron/Siemens PLC's and HMI's
    • Vision systems experience would be an asset
    • Knowledge of MS Office packages (word, excel, PowerPoint). Knowledge of Visual Basic, and Macro in Excel is highly desirable
    • Knowledge of MIG spot welding and tube bending processes would be an asset
    • Able to work in a fast-paced environment
    • Solid technical communication skills, self-motivated, and able to work with minimum supervision
    • Able to work under extreme demands and tight schedules
    • Able to accept directions and change directions as required
    • Excellent English language, communication, and presentation skills (both verbal and written)
    • Basic understanding of WHMIS, IMDS, Ergonomics, Healthy and Safety regulations
    • Willingness and ability to travel
